Correcting Rename Errors
If RENAME error 82 is reported, the file is an SQL program file and cannot be renamed 
unless TMF is running. Check that TMF is running, then select the Retry option.

Cause. The specified file was expected in its real and fabricated names because a 
different version of this file is part of the previous configuration. The old version of the 
file, in the previous configuration, could not be renamed to its fabricated name because 
of an OPEN error.
Effect. The correct version of the file cannot be placed. ZPHIRNM prompts you to 
ignore this error, ignore all occurrences of this error, retry the task, undo the TSV, or 
request more information. (The default is to undo the TSV.)
Recovery. To retry the file, correct it, then select the Retry option. To leave the file out 
of the configuration and continue with the next file in the TSV, ignore this error or 
ignore all occurrences of this error in this run of ZPHIRNM. Otherwise, undo the 
processing performed on this TSV and continue with the next TSV. This TSV is marked 
as incomplete and can be reprocessed later.
